JVC EVERIO HYBRID GZ-MG330 Battery error?

I bought a replacement data battery BN-VF-808U from Digicowfish through Amazon.com. (?made by PomerPower).
It fits nciely to my JVC Everio GZ-MG330 which uses a BN-VF808U data battery. However, JVC gives a screen message:Communicating Error.
Now I have solved my Communication Error by using a jumper cable provided with the replacement battery BN-VF808U to connect the attached replacement battery to the camcorder. There is a DC input socket on the camcorder. There is also a DC input socket on the replacement battery for direct connection.

How to find replacement adapter for GR-D70AS

Order the original adapter from JVC. The adapter supplies the correct current requirements to operate the battery charge circuit. JVC's web site is JVC.COM. The correct charger will provide up to 1.5 amperes of current for the charge circuit at approx. 11 volts DC. Good Luck Joe Weibel Custom Electronics (customelectronics.org)

JVC GR-D350U Digital Video Camera "Communication Error"

Just found a workaround for the "cheap battery" problem. The problem is that there is some circuitry in the more expensive JVC batteries that the generics don't have. When this isn't detected by the camcorder, it won't function. It's a neat trick to make you buy the proprietary battery. Also suspecting that with the JVC battery, if the circuitry gets fried for some reason, the battery will no longer work. Well, the generic battery I have has a plug in the back of it so you can charge it with the JVC factory supplied charger. There was also a jumper cord supplied with the camcorder. Plug this in the back of your cheap battery, plug the other end into your DC port on your camera, and voila! You're in business. Downsides are that you have a short cord between the battery and camcorder and the battery indicator won't work so you'll need a spare.
